Troubled Paws: Finding Fast-Acting Itch Relief for Dogs

Dealing with an itchy dog can be frustrating as well as both of you. It's important to find the cause of the itching before trying to treat it. Common triggers include allergies, parasites, and skin irritations. Once you know what's causing the itch, you can choose the most effective treatment option. For rapid relief, consider using a soothing topical cream containing ingredients like oatmeal or aloe vera. These products can help calm inflammation and itching. Additionally, you can try giving your dog an antihistamine to block allergic reactions. It's important to talk to your veterinarian before using any new medications on your dog. They can help you determine the most appropriate treatment plan for your furry friend's needs.

Organic Remedies for Canine Itching

Itchy skin can lead to real discomfort for your canine companion. Before reaching for the chemical-laden solutions, consider these organic remedies that may help your dog's itchy woes. A healthy supply of omega-3 fatty acids can make a big difference. Adding fish oil or flaxseed to your dog's meals may minimize get more info inflammation and itching.

Another effective remedy is a {oatmeal bath|. Oatmeal has anti-inflammatory properties that can soothe irritation. Add some colloidal oatmeal to a lukewarm bath and let your dog enjoy 10-15 minutes. For topical itching, applying aloe vera gel can reduce inflammation. Always consult with your veterinarian before trying any new remedy, particularly when severe itching or other health concerns.
